Mariner Medicine

October the 1th 5000
In the quiet morning of the fifth day the companions slowly woke up, each one tending to his own activities, Griselda was training her combat skills in a quiet corner in the cargo-hold, Erleothir was attending to the dogs, Gustavius and Alast were on deck and Mulchanor and Lightning were at the infirmary. Due to one more episode of sudden sickness Ligthning had to change clothes and wash himself as much as possible and decided it was time to have a talk with the doctor on-board.

While feeding the dog Erleothir suddenly noticed the noise of quick steps right behind him. Upon turning around he noticed two blond mariners rushing up the stairs, slightly intrigued he decided to go after them. On the deck Gustavius was about to have a chat with Franklin when suddenly a loud explosion was to be heard. Alast, Erleothir (who was now on deck) and Gustavius immediately turned around to scan the deck but there was no apparent damage. On the second deck Griselda could hear the that the sound of the explosion was very intense and coming form the first deck just below her. In the infirmary all hell broke loose. While Lightning tried to hide in a corner, behind Mulchanor, who gladly shook him to get him out of his panic. Running naked to the door, the magician forgot it was closed. And smashed into it, soundly. Unsuccessful the dwarf rushed to the door to see what happened but was intercepted by the doctor "sorry master dwarf, none leaves my infirmary without authorization" - "but something is going on out there, we need to check!" - "I'm the one deciding if you may leave or not and for now i decide you need some medicine" quickly he waved at one of his assistant. A second explosion shook the boat. "leave me alone with you medicine you quacksalber" roared Mulchanor and pushed the assistant away "I will..." his sentence cam to an abrupt end as another assistant took the easiest way to calm a dwarf and knocked him out from behind. Finally Lightning reacted "what are you doing to...." - "that one needs medicine too!" yelled the doctor. and suddenly unconsciousness engulfed Lightning as well. The ship was starting to sink.

On the deck the two suspicious mariners were rushing for the main mast and climbing up to the crow's nest. "Make sure they don't come down" ordered Erleothir quickly to Gustavius and ran off to the back of the ship to warn the captain. he was quickly followed by Alast as a second explosion was also to be heard. "captain, I just saw those two blond mariners..." - "we don't have blond crew members on board, if you excuse me for a second; all available men under deck ! check for breaches and man the pumps, I want regular damage reports; you were saying, knight ?" - "those two over there surely have something to do with the explosions, we need to make sure that they don't..." his sentence was interrupted by the noise of a body crashing on deck. one of the mariners had just fall from the crow's nest- without any scream. Even the loud noise of broken bones couldn't attract Alast attention.






Below deck Griselda was on her way to find the cause of the first explosion when she suddenly heard a mechanical clicking sound and instinctively thrown herself aside. This saved her life, as the second, much louder explosion shook the boat. Griselda ran down to find the dogs and set them free, sadly three of them drowned before. Nine of them were now saved and running wild on the deck above. Meanwhile on the bridge Erleothir suddenly remembered the other party members and sent Alast to find Griselda. Seeing now the damage and the mariner fixing the breaches, pumping out the constant coming water she immediately helped them. Pumping harder than any man she sang to boost their morale. Which she did pretty well in fact. As unusual as a women can be in a boat, this one was helping them and proved to be worth to be one of them.

On the main deck Erleothir received an harsh complaint from the captain as he should start investigating the ship for further devices or at least arrest the remaining saboteurs. Meanwhile Gustavius, who guarded the crow's nest from below rushed for the dead corpse to look for any evidences on the dead body. Sadly, not only he could not recognize anything due to condition of the corpse but he managed to stuck his clothes in a broken bone. A growing shadow hovering over him was the advanced warning of an incoming close encounter with the second saboteur who had jumped as well. Luckily for him the body did not him him but crashed on the ground directly next to him with a disgusting noise covering him with guts and blood. Alast was about to curse when Erleothir promptly asked him to search for the other team-members. But things were far from being over.

Griselda was still pumping and chanting while the mariners were filling the breaches in the hull when another crew member entered the cargo-hold holding a ticking mechanical device in his hands. "Hey, look guys, I found some...." his sentence was interrupted as the device exploded in his hands killing him and filling the room with debris and acrid smoke. Full of blood but safe the mariners and Griselda continued to pump and fix the boat. Her singing could take the thought of the possibility of another exploding device nearby as much as the fear of water could do it. While Erleothir ordered some sailors on deck to carry down the bodies of the saboteurs to the infirmary for autopsy, Gustavius rushed to grab his gun in the cabin.

In the infirmary Erleothir used all his presence to get the truth from the medic. As now his friends had head injuries. Threatening the doctor he made him respect the group more, or at least, take care of them differently. Out of fear probably. He even traded with him to clean up the naked mage as he got sea sick. Two gold coins for an uncertain amount of work. A shit load of it actually. Jack was the man up to do it, reluctantly. Alast couldn't resist and said smiling at the medic:
-"you could have a good carrier has a Buccaneer"
Meanwhile some mariners cleaned the remains of the bodies, allowing a better inspection. Nevertheless, nothing were found. In his epic quest to retrieve Griselda, Alast kept asking the busy mariners till he got enough information to found her. Instead he ran twice in circle around the ship and finally missed a step on a flight of stairs. Mulchanor woke up, trying to find a fight instead of an explanation. Thankfully, the Knight could calm down the situation before it got out of hand.

- JAAAAAAAAAAAACCCCCCCCCCCCKKKKKK!

Once again the mage got his bowels cleaned. Poor jack grumbled but executed himself cursing both doctor and mage. Meanwhile Gustavius prepared to encounter a third saboteur was rushing for the cargo-hold were the bombs exploded when he suddenly heard growling and chewing behind him. The dogs were eating parts of the wares loaded on board and freely running around, he cursed and closed the door to make sure the dogs couldn't do more damage in other parts of the ship. The pumping and the moaning of the hurt mariners started to annoy Griselda, but not as much as the fact she was alone in that cargo hold, full of dead bodies, smoke and floating debris. "where are they all, what is going on ? why is none coming down here to help us?" were her thoughts. On the first deck, sleeping naked in the sick bay Lightning's will was off and let go all his fears.

- JACCCKKKK! Called the doctor.

Quickly assessing the damages around her, she saw with relief that the breaches were successfully repaired and the water level was going down. Satisfied she made a sign at a young mariner to replace her at the pump and decided to go upstairs. On her way up she met Gustavius they briefly exchanged some words but the language barrier was too wide, while Gustavius had a hard time understanding she was annoyed none helped her, Griselda managed to understand the problem with the dogs int he cargo-hold. She entered the room were the dogs were still feasting upon the wares loaded in the boxes they had scratched open. Her innate ability to master animals helped her in grouping all the dogs and tying them to a nearby post, thus preventing them doing more damage and being out of the way of the crew running up and down the decks.

On the lowest deck, Gustavius successfully managed to make a fool of himself as he entered the room where the devices exploded, stared at the now repaired breaches in the hull and casually asked the people in the room were the bombs exploded. It was a relief for the mariners to have a good laugh at the strange blood covered dwarf. "Ok guys, very funny... point is, I see two breaches, but I heard three explosions. where did the third bomb detonated and why is there no apparent damage?" - "A fellow mariner found it" - "where was he coming from ?" - "that way..." said the mariners while pointing at the stern side of the ship. Gustavius cautiously advanced in the dark corridor. After a few meters a dead body fell down on him, burying him almost completely. "definitely not my day..." He managed to free himself after a while but noticed that his trusty rifle was now broken and could not be used anymore... He investigated the body and the area. It was the first officer. Killed with a dagger. Professionally back-stabbed in his heart. also a disabled bomb could be found nearby.

By the advanced stage of decomposition Gustavius could tell he was dead for a couple of days. Maybe three. For him it meant that they were preparing this sabotages to happen in a right timing. Why would they had waited if they were found? Griselda was not to encounter Alast there, as she went up, willing to check on her friends or injured people whom could have information for her. Gustavius requested to lock the door with the mariner body, it may contains clue about all of this. As they were summoned by the captain in his cabin, Lightning was still in black out. The captain was now grave but sure of his saying.
- Fellow companions, The two man were zealots of the religion of the dark spawn. The doctor could find some residues of the drugs they take. They are meant to die for their cause if needed. Franklin made the boat checked, twice for enemies and more surprises. But neither were found. This mess had his boat partially damaged, seven men were killed. Two he never met before. His second was one of the victims. Now he had a crew of ninety five men and fifteen armed guards.
While diner was served in a frugal way, the name Jack echoed once again. Surely Lightning was about to wake up soon. Otherwise he would die dried from dysentery. While all those new information were tolling Griselda mind, she went to see how Lightning was doing.

A few days of rests allowed Gustavius to learn how to salt fish. Meanwhile he also spotted a dolphin. Bringing good luck to the crew. As least they though so. In the midday of the eleventh day Lightning woke up, hitting Griselda out of his coma. He released himself again, spoiling on Griselda this time. Anyway the kindness from the Telchos didn't dropped and she gave him some food. Lightning didn't even notice he was naked under his cover. Neither the death looks from Jack seemed to perturb him.

Outside, the rhythm seemed to change. The captain screamed loud enough for them to listen:
-GIAK SHIP AHEAD!
-PREPARE TO FIGHT BOYS!

Now they understood why the blonds went to the crow's nest. They expected this boat to be there.
